<?php declare(strict_types=1);
 | 
						|
 | 
						|
namespace PhpParser;
 | 
						|
 | 
						|
class NodeTraverser implements NodeTraverserInterface {
 | 
						|
    /**
 | 
						|
     * @deprecated Use NodeVisitor::DONT_TRAVERSE_CHILDREN instead.
 | 
						|
     */
 | 
						|
    public const DONT_TRAVERSE_CHILDREN = NodeVisitor::DONT_TRAVERSE_CHILDREN;
 | 
						|
 | 
						|
    /**
 | 
						|
     * @deprecated Use NodeVisitor::STOP_TRAVERSAL instead.
 | 
						|
     */
 | 
						|
    public const STOP_TRAVERSAL = NodeVisitor::STOP_TRAVERSAL;
 | 
						|
 | 
						|
    /**
 | 
						|
     * @deprecated Use NodeVisitor::REMOVE_NODE instead.
 | 
						|
     */
 | 
						|
    public const REMOVE_NODE = NodeVisitor::REMOVE_NODE;
 | 
						|
 | 
						|
    /**
 | 
						|
     * @deprecated Use NodeVisitor::DONT_TRAVERSE_CURRENT_AND_CHILDREN instead.
 | 
						|
     */
 | 
						|
    public const DONT_TRAVERSE_CURRENT_AND_CHILDREN = NodeVisitor::DONT_TRAVERSE_CURRENT_AND_CHILDREN;
 | 
						|
 | 
						|
    /** @var list<NodeVisitor> Visitors */
 | 
						|
    protected array $visitors = [];
 | 
						|
 | 
						|
    /** @var bool Whether traversal should be stopped */
 | 
						|
    protected bool $stopTraversal;
 | 
						|
 | 
						|
    /**
 | 
						|
     * Create a traverser with the given visitors.
 | 
						|
     *
 | 
						|
     * @param NodeVisitor ...$visitors Node visitors
 | 
						|
     */
 | 
						|
    public function __construct(NodeVisitor ...$visitors) {
 | 
						|
        $this->visitors = $visitors;
 | 
						|
    }
 | 
						|
 | 
						|
    /**
 | 
						|
     * Adds a visitor.
 | 
						|
     *
 | 
						|
     * @param NodeVisitor $visitor Visitor to add
 | 
						|
     */
 | 
						|
    public function addVisitor(NodeVisitor $visitor): void {
 | 
						|
        $this->visitors[] = $visitor;
 | 
						|
    }
 | 
						|
 | 
						|
    /**
 | 
						|
     * Removes an added visitor.
 | 
						|
     */
 | 
						|
    public function removeVisitor(NodeVisitor $visitor): void {
 | 
						|
        $index = array_search($visitor, $this->visitors);
 | 
						|
        if ($index !== false) {
 | 
						|
            array_splice($this->visitors, $index, 1, []);
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
    /**
 | 
						|
     * Traverses an array of nodes using the registered visitors.
 | 
						|
     *
 | 
						|
     * @param Node[] $nodes Array of nodes
 | 
						|
     *
 | 
						|
     * @return Node[] Traversed array of nodes
 | 
						|
     */
 | 
						|
    public function traverse(array $nodes): array {
 | 
						|
        $this->stopTraversal = false;
 | 
						|
 | 
						|
        foreach ($this->visitors as $visitor) {
 | 
						|
            if (null !== $return = $visitor->beforeTraverse($nodes)) {
 | 
						|
                $nodes = $return;
 | 
						|
            }
 | 
						|
        }
 | 
						|
 | 
						|
        $nodes = $this->traverseArray($nodes);
 | 
						|
 | 
						|
        for ($i = \count($this->visitors) - 1; $i >= 0; --$i) {
 | 
						|
            $visitor = $this->visitors[$i];
 | 
						|
            if (null !== $return = $visitor->afterTraverse($nodes)) {
 | 
						|
                $nodes = $return;
 | 
						|
            }
 | 
						|
        }
 | 
						|
 | 
						|
        return $nodes;
 | 
						|
    }
 | 
						|
 | 
						|
    /**
 | 
						|
     * Recursively traverse a node.
 | 
						|
     *
 | 
						|
     * @param Node $node Node to traverse.
 | 
						|
     */
 | 
						|
    protected function traverseNode(Node $node): void {
 | 
						|
        foreach ($node->getSubNodeNames() as $name) {
 | 
						|
            $subNode = $node->$name;
 | 
						|
 | 
						|
            if (\is_array($subNode)) {
 | 
						|
                $node->$name = $this->traverseArray($subNode);
 | 
						|
                if ($this->stopTraversal) {
 | 
						|
                    break;
 | 
						|
                }
 | 
						|
 | 
						|
                continue;
 | 
						|
            }
 | 
						|
 | 
						|
            if (!$subNode instanceof Node) {
 | 
						|
                continue;
 | 
						|
            }
 | 
						|
 | 
						|
            $traverseChildren = true;
 | 
						|
            $visitorIndex = -1;
 | 
						|
 | 
						|
            foreach ($this->visitors as $visitorIndex => $visitor) {
 | 
						|
                $return = $visitor->enterNode($subNode);
 | 
						|
                if (null !== $return) {
 | 
						|
                    if ($return instanceof Node) {
 | 
						|
                        $this->ensureReplacementReasonable($subNode, $return);
 | 
						|
                        $subNode = $node->$name = $return;
 | 
						|
                    } elseif (NodeVisitor::DONT_TRAVERSE_CHILDREN === $return) {
 | 
						|
                        $traverseChildren = false;
 | 
						|
                    } elseif (NodeVisitor::DONT_TRAVERSE_CURRENT_AND_CHILDREN === $return) {
 | 
						|
                        $traverseChildren = false;
 | 
						|
                        break;
 | 
						|
                    } elseif (NodeVisitor::STOP_TRAVERSAL === $return) {
 | 
						|
                        $this->stopTraversal = true;
 | 
						|
                        break 2;
 | 
						|
                    } elseif (NodeVisitor::REPLACE_WITH_NULL === $return) {
 | 
						|
                        $node->$name = null;
 | 
						|
                        continue 2;
 | 
						|
                    } else {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'enterNode() returned invalid value of type ' . gettype($return)
 | 
						|
                        );
 | 
						|
                    }
 | 
						|
                }
 | 
						|
            }
 | 
						|
 | 
						|
            if ($traverseChildren) {
 | 
						|
                $this->traverseNode($subNode);
 | 
						|
                if ($this->stopTraversal) {
 | 
						|
                    break;
 | 
						|
                }
 | 
						|
            }
 | 
						|
 | 
						|
            for (; $visitorIndex >= 0; --$visitorIndex) {
 | 
						|
                $visitor = $this->visitors[$visitorIndex];
 | 
						|
                $return = $visitor->leaveNode($subNode);
 | 
						|
 | 
						|
                if (null !== $return) {
 | 
						|
                    if ($return instanceof Node) {
 | 
						|
                        $this->ensureReplacementReasonable($subNode, $return);
 | 
						|
                        $subNode = $node->$name = $return;
 | 
						|
                    } elseif (NodeVisitor::STOP_TRAVERSAL === $return) {
 | 
						|
                        $this->stopTraversal = true;
 | 
						|
                        break 2;
 | 
						|
                    } elseif (NodeVisitor::REPLACE_WITH_NULL === $return) {
 | 
						|
                        $node->$name = null;
 | 
						|
                        break;
 | 
						|
                    } elseif (\is_array($return)) {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'leaveNode() may only return an array ' .
 | 
						|
                            'if the parent structure is an array'
 | 
						|
                        );
 | 
						|
                    } else {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'leaveNode() returned invalid value of type ' . gettype($return)
 | 
						|
                        );
 | 
						|
                    }
 | 
						|
                }
 | 
						|
            }
 | 
						|
        }
 | 
						|
    }
 | 
						|
 | 
						|
    /**
 | 
						|
     * Recursively traverse array (usually of nodes).
 | 
						|
     *
 | 
						|
     * @param array $nodes Array to traverse
 | 
						|
     *
 | 
						|
     * @return array Result of traversal (may be original array or changed one)
 | 
						|
     */
 | 
						|
    protected function traverseArray(array $nodes): array {
 | 
						|
        $doNodes = [];
 | 
						|
 | 
						|
        foreach ($nodes as $i => $node) {
 | 
						|
            if (!$node instanceof Node) {
 | 
						|
                if (\is_array($node)) {
 | 
						|
                    throw new \LogicException('Invalid node structure: Contains nested arrays');
 | 
						|
                }
 | 
						|
                continue;
 | 
						|
            }
 | 
						|
 | 
						|
            $traverseChildren = true;
 | 
						|
            $visitorIndex = -1;
 | 
						|
 | 
						|
            foreach ($this->visitors as $visitorIndex => $visitor) {
 | 
						|
                $return = $visitor->enterNode($node);
 | 
						|
                if (null !== $return) {
 | 
						|
                    if ($return instanceof Node) {
 | 
						|
                        $this->ensureReplacementReasonable($node, $return);
 | 
						|
                        $nodes[$i] = $node = $return;
 | 
						|
                    } elseif (\is_array($return)) {
 | 
						|
                        $doNodes[] = [$i, $return];
 | 
						|
                        continue 2;
 | 
						|
                    } elseif (NodeVisitor::REMOVE_NODE === $return) {
 | 
						|
                        $doNodes[] = [$i, []];
 | 
						|
                        continue 2;
 | 
						|
                    } elseif (NodeVisitor::DONT_TRAVERSE_CHILDREN === $return) {
 | 
						|
                        $traverseChildren = false;
 | 
						|
                    } elseif (NodeVisitor::DONT_TRAVERSE_CURRENT_AND_CHILDREN === $return) {
 | 
						|
                        $traverseChildren = false;
 | 
						|
                        break;
 | 
						|
                    } elseif (NodeVisitor::STOP_TRAVERSAL === $return) {
 | 
						|
                        $this->stopTraversal = true;
 | 
						|
                        break 2;
 | 
						|
                    } elseif (NodeVisitor::REPLACE_WITH_NULL === $return) {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'REPLACE_WITH_NULL can not be used if the parent structure is an array');
 | 
						|
                    } else {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'enterNode() returned invalid value of type ' . gettype($return)
 | 
						|
                        );
 | 
						|
                    }
 | 
						|
                }
 | 
						|
            }
 | 
						|
 | 
						|
            if ($traverseChildren) {
 | 
						|
                $this->traverseNode($node);
 | 
						|
                if ($this->stopTraversal) {
 | 
						|
                    break;
 | 
						|
                }
 | 
						|
            }
 | 
						|
 | 
						|
            for (; $visitorIndex >= 0; --$visitorIndex) {
 | 
						|
                $visitor = $this->visitors[$visitorIndex];
 | 
						|
                $return = $visitor->leaveNode($node);
 | 
						|
 | 
						|
                if (null !== $return) {
 | 
						|
                    if ($return instanceof Node) {
 | 
						|
                        $this->ensureReplacementReasonable($node, $return);
 | 
						|
                        $nodes[$i] = $node = $return;
 | 
						|
                    } elseif (\is_array($return)) {
 | 
						|
                        $doNodes[] = [$i, $return];
 | 
						|
                        break;
 | 
						|
                    } elseif (NodeVisitor::REMOVE_NODE === $return) {
 | 
						|
                        $doNodes[] = [$i, []];
 | 
						|
                        break;
 | 
						|
                    } elseif (NodeVisitor::STOP_TRAVERSAL === $return) {
 | 
						|
                        $this->stopTraversal = true;
 | 
						|
                        break 2;
 | 
						|
                    } elseif (NodeVisitor::REPLACE_WITH_NULL === $return) {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'REPLACE_WITH_NULL can not be used if the parent structure is an array');
 | 
						|
                    } else {
 | 
						|
                        throw new \LogicException(
 | 
						|
                            'leaveNode() returned invalid value of type ' . gettype($return)
 | 
						|
                        );
 | 
						|
                    }
 | 
						|
                }
 | 
						|
            }
 | 
						|
        }
 | 
						|
 | 
						|
        if (!empty($doNodes)) {
 | 
						|
            while (list($i, $replace) = array_pop($doNodes)) {
 | 
						|
                array_splice($nodes, $i, 1, $replace);
 | 
						|
            }
 | 
						|
        }
 | 
						|
 | 
						|
        return $nodes;
 | 
						|
    }
 | 
						|
 | 
						|
    private function ensureReplacementReasonable(Node $old, Node $new): void {
 | 
						|
        if ($old instanceof Node\Stmt && $new instanceof Node\Expr) {
 | 
						|
            throw new \LogicException(
 | 
						|
                "Trying to replace statement ({$old->getType()}) " .
 | 
						|
                "with expression ({$new->getType()}). Are you missing a " .
 | 
						|
                "Stmt_Expression wrapper?"
 | 
						|
            );
 | 
						|
        }
 | 
						|
 | 
						|
        if ($old instanceof Node\Expr && $new instanceof Node\Stmt) {
 | 
						|
            throw new \LogicException(
 | 
						|
                "Trying to replace expression ({$old->getType()}) " .
 | 
						|
                "with statement ({$new->getType()})"
 | 
						|
            );
 | 
						|
        }
 | 
						|
    }
 | 
						|
}
